* [PATCH net 1/4] netfilter: ipt_CLUSTERIP: fix refcount leak in clusterip_tg_check()
  2022-01-06 21:51 [PATCH net 0/4] Netfilter fixes for net Pablo Neira Ayuso
@ 2022-01-06 21:51 ` Pablo Neira Ayuso
  2022-01-07  2:50   ` patchwork-bot+netdevbpf
  2022-01-06 21:51 ` [PATCH net 2/4] selftests: netfilter: switch to socat for tests using -q option Pablo Neira Ayuso
                   ` (2 subsequent siblings)
  3 siblings, 1 reply; 17+ messages in thread
From: Pablo Neira Ayuso @ 2022-01-06 21:51 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: netfilter-devel; +Cc: davem, netdev, kuba

From: Xin Xiong <xiongx18@fudan.edu.cn>

The issue takes place in one error path of clusterip_tg_check(). When
memcmp() returns nonzero, the function simply returns the error code,
forgetting to decrease the reference count of a clusterip_config
object, which is bumped earlier by clusterip_config_find_get(). This
may incur reference count leak.

Fix this issue by decrementing the refcount of the object in specific
error path.

Fixes: 06aa151ad1fc74 ("netfilter: ipt_CLUSTERIP: check MAC address when duplicate config is set")
Signed-off-by: Xin Xiong <xiongx18@fudan.edu.cn>
Signed-off-by: Xiyu Yang <xiyuyang19@fudan.edu.cn>
Signed-off-by: Xin Tan <tanxin.ctf@gmail.com>
Signed-off-by: Pablo Neira Ayuso <pablo@netfilter.org>
---
 net/ipv4/netfilter/ipt_CLUSTERIP.c | 5 ++++-
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/net/ipv4/netfilter/ipt_CLUSTERIP.c b/net/ipv4/netfilter/ipt_CLUSTERIP.c
index 8fd1aba8af31..b518f20c9a24 100644
--- a/net/ipv4/netfilter/ipt_CLUSTERIP.c
+++ b/net/ipv4/netfilter/ipt_CLUSTERIP.c
@@ -520,8 +520,11 @@ static int clusterip_tg_check(const struct xt_tgchk_param *par)
 			if (IS_ERR(config))
 				return PTR_ERR(config);
 		}
-	} else if (memcmp(&config->clustermac, &cipinfo->clustermac, ETH_ALEN))
+	} else if (memcmp(&config->clustermac, &cipinfo->clustermac, ETH_ALEN)) {
+		clusterip_config_entry_put(config);
+		clusterip_config_put(config);
 		return -EINVAL;
+	}
 
 	ret = nf_ct_netns_get(par->net, par->family);
 	if (ret < 0) {

* [PATCH net 3/4] netfilter: nft_payload: do not update layer 4 checksum when mangling fragments
  2022-01-06 21:51 [PATCH net 0/4] Netfilter fixes for net Pablo Neira Ayuso
  2022-01-06 21:51 ` [PATCH net 1/4] netfilter: ipt_CLUSTERIP: fix refcount leak in clusterip_tg_check() Pablo Neira Ayuso
  2022-01-06 21:51 ` [PATCH net 2/4] selftests: netfilter: switch to socat for tests using -q option Pablo Neira Ayuso
@ 2022-01-06 21:51 ` Pablo Neira Ayuso
  2022-01-06 21:51 ` [PATCH net 4/4] netfilter: nft_set_pipapo: allocate pcpu scratch maps on clone Pablo Neira Ayuso
  3 siblings, 0 replies; 17+ messages in thread
From: Pablo Neira Ayuso @ 2022-01-06 21:51 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: netfilter-devel; +Cc: davem, netdev, kuba

IP fragments do not come with the transport header, hence skip bogus
layer 4 checksum updates.

Fixes: 1814096980bb ("netfilter: nft_payload: layer 4 checksum adjustment for pseudoheader fields")
Reported-and-tested-by: Steffen Weinreich <steve@weinreich.org>
Signed-off-by: Pablo Neira Ayuso <pablo@netfilter.org>
---
 net/netfilter/nft_payload.c | 3 +++
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+)

diff --git a/net/netfilter/nft_payload.c b/net/netfilter/nft_payload.c
index bd689938a2e0..58e96a0fe0b4 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/nft_payload.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/nft_payload.c
@@ -546,6 +546,9 @@ static int nft_payload_l4csum_offset(const struct nft_pktinfo *pkt,
 				     struct sk_buff *skb,
 				     unsigned int *l4csum_offset)
 {
+	if (pkt->fragoff)
+		return -1;
+
 	switch (pkt->tprot) {
 	case IPPROTO_TCP:
 		*l4csum_offset = offsetof(struct tcphdr, check);

* [PATCH net 4/4] netfilter: nft_set_pipapo: allocate pcpu scratch maps on clone
  2022-01-06 21:51 [PATCH net 0/4] Netfilter fixes for net Pablo Neira Ayuso
                   ` (2 preceding siblings ...)
  2022-01-06 21:51 ` [PATCH net 3/4] netfilter: nft_payload: do not update layer 4 checksum when mangling fragments Pablo Neira Ayuso
@ 2022-01-06 21:51 ` Pablo Neira Ayuso
  3 siblings, 0 replies; 17+ messages in thread
From: Pablo Neira Ayuso @ 2022-01-06 21:51 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: netfilter-devel; +Cc: davem, netdev, kuba

From: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>

This is needed in case a new transaction is made that doesn't insert any
new elements into an already existing set.

Else, after second 'nft -f ruleset.txt', lookups in such a set will fail
because ->lookup() encounters raw_cpu_ptr(m->scratch) == NULL.

For the initial rule load, insertion of elements takes care of the
allocation, but for rule reloads this isn't guaranteed: we might not
have additions to the set.

Fixes: 3c4287f62044a90e ("nf_tables: Add set type for arbitrary concatenation of ranges")
Reported-by: etkaar <lists.netfilter.org@prvy.eu>
Signed-off-by: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>
Reviewed-by: Stefano Brivio <sbrivio@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Pablo Neira Ayuso <pablo@netfilter.org>
---
 net/netfilter/nft_set_pipapo.c | 8 ++++++++
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+)

diff --git a/net/netfilter/nft_set_pipapo.c b/net/netfilter/nft_set_pipapo.c
index dce866d93fee..2c8051d8cca6 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/nft_set_pipapo.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/nft_set_pipapo.c
@@ -1290,6 +1290,11 @@ static struct nft_pipapo_match *pipapo_clone(struct nft_pipapo_match *old)
 	if (!new->scratch_aligned)
 		goto out_scratch;
 #endif
+	for_each_possible_cpu(i)
+		*per_cpu_ptr(new->scratch, i) = NULL;
+
+	if (pipapo_realloc_scratch(new, old->bsize_max))
+		goto out_scratch_realloc;
 
 	rcu_head_init(&new->rcu);
 
@@ -1334,6 +1339,9 @@ static struct nft_pipapo_match *pipapo_clone(struct nft_pipapo_match *old)
 		kvfree(dst->lt);
 		dst--;
 	}
+out_scratch_realloc:
+	for_each_possible_cpu(i)
+		kfree(*per_cpu_ptr(new->scratch, i));
 #ifdef NFT_PIPAPO_ALIGN
 	free_percpu(new->scratch_aligned);
 #endif

Hi,

The following patchset contains Netfilter fixes for net:

1) Perform SCTP vtag verification for ABORT/SHUTDOWN_COMPLETE according
   to RFC 9260, Sect 8.5.1.

2) Fix infinite loop if SCTP chunk size is zero in for_each_sctp_chunk().
   And remove useless check in this macro too.

3) Revert DATA_SENT state in the SCTP tracker, this was applied in the
   previous merge window. Next patch in this series provides a more
   simple approach to multihoming support.

4) Unify HEARTBEAT_ACKED and ESTABLISHED states for SCTP multihoming
   support, use default ESTABLISHED of 210 seconds based on
   heartbeat timeout * maximum number of retransmission + round-trip timeout.
   Otherwise, SCTP conntrack entry that represents secondary paths
   remain stale in the table for up to 5 days.

This is a slightly large batch with fixes for the SCTP connection
tracking helper, all patches from Sriram Yagnaraman.
